Five years since last visit

My wife and I honeymooned in Playa 5 years ago this month because it was the anti-Cancun and we loved it. We are returning in a week and a half and I have several questions.

1. We live about 40 miles SW of Austin and the smokey haze from the agricultural burning from Central America (Guatamala?) and Chiapas has been really bad for about a week. What is it like there and is there rain expected soon to ameliorate the fires?

2. We are coming down with some friends who somehow talked us into staying at Fisherman's Village. My wife and I loathe all-inclusives and will bolt at the first glitch. We stayed at Sacbe B&B our last time and would like to return there, is it still a going concern?

3. Someone please tell me that Playa has not become Cancun Jr.

Thanks for any help and can't wait to get there, I can already taste the garlic shrimp at Ronny's.

re: pdc change

Dear Xetc ... Cancun, Jr.? I vote no ... Change? Like the wind but it is essentially the same, just more of the same, and places close, open, change names etc .... Ronny's Steak House remains at same hotel whose name escapes me ... Sacbe B&B is now Villas Sacbe, a luxury condo for sale venue which does not rent night to night; Ted Rhodes, the B&B owner, remains a principal and also has a jungle housing project going called Pueblo Sacbe which has its own forum on this home page (see icons) .... Fishman Village? no info except that it is a short walk to the main bus terminal at Ave. Juarez .... weather? not sure, but Associated Press, Wash. Post have Mexico news pages and try weather channel info pages for Cancun ... my guess is that jungle fires smoke from Chiappas would be blown inward and outward as in West & North and not North & East ... the strongest winds on the coast tend to blow in & circle back softer ... you may ask this question separate for better BB info ...kjtom
